Berlin, a capital of Germany, a city with the long and full of events history has a lot of interesting places to visit. Now the most of the places attracting tourists are connected with not-so-distant past - the Third Reich, the division of Berlin and its reunion. The matter is that during World War II many ancient monuments were destroyed by the aviation of the allies. Many architectural must-sees are the reminders of the painful pages in Berlin history, but may be it will help to refrain from repetition of these tragedies.

Berlin museums |
|
|
Berlin can boast more than 80 museums. Here you can see such world-known masterpieces as Nefertiti bust, a great collection of Rembrandt works and the treasures of the ancient East. There are few city with such full archeology collections. For almost half a century Berlin was separated into two parts and some museums duplicate each other. For example, there are two Egypt museums, two museums, devoted to the city and so on.

Berlin shops and markets
|
|
|
Berlin central street - Kurfurstendamm, also called Ku'damm is full of different shops - there are prestigious boutiques and small shops with cheap souvenirs. The most of Berlin citizens prefer to make shopping here, but the neighboring streets between Breitscheidplatz and Olivaer Platz are also popular.

Berlin restaurants and bars |
|
|
Berlin citizens like to eat, but their own, German cuisine is not very refined, that's why there are a lot of restaurants with international dishes from all over the world. A lot of immigrants from Turkey live in Berlin and thus Turkish cuisine is becoming more and more popular. Naturally, Berlin has a lot of prestigious restaurants to satisfy the most demanding travelers.
